Amazon SEO Tools Your Guide to Ranking Higher

Understanding Amazon’s A9 Algorithm

Before diving into specific tools, it’s crucial to grasp how Amazon’s A9 algorithm works. A9 isn’t just about keywords; it’s a complex system considering factors like conversion rate, customer reviews, pricing, listing quality, and inventory. Understanding these interconnected elements is vital for effective SEO. Simply stuffing keywords won’t cut it; you need a holistic approach that optimizes your entire listing.

Keyword Research: Finding the Right Terms

Effective keyword research forms the bedrock of your Amazon SEO strategy. Tools like Sonar, Helium 10, and Jungle Scout provide powerful keyword research capabilities. These platforms help you discover high-volume, low-competition keywords relevant to your product. They often go beyond basic keyword suggestions, offering data on search volume, competition, and even potential revenue. Don’t just focus on primary keywords; explore long-tail keywords (more specific phrases) for better targeting.

Listing Optimization: Crafting a Compelling Product Page

Your product listing is your storefront on Amazon. It needs to be compelling and informative. Tools can help you optimize various elements, including your title, bullet points, product description, and backend keywords. Helium 10’s Scribbles tool, for example, helps craft compelling bullet points that highlight key features and benefits. Pay close attention to keyword placement while maintaining a natural and readable flow—don’t sacrifice readability for keyword density.

Review Management: Building Trust and Credibility

Positive reviews are gold on Amazon. They directly influence your ranking and conversion rates. While you can’t buy reviews, you can actively encourage them. Respond to both positive and negative reviews promptly and professionally. Tools like Feedback Genius can help you automate review requests and manage your overall reputation. Responding thoughtfully shows customers you value their feedback and builds trust.

Competitor Analysis: Identifying Opportunities

Understanding your competition is critical. Tools like Sonar and Jungle Scout provide detailed competitor analysis. You can see their keyword rankings, pricing strategies, and listing performance. This information lets you identify gaps in the market, find untapped keywords, and refine your own strategies to gain a competitive edge. Analyzing your competitors helps you understand what’s working and what’s not within your niche.

Pricing Optimization: Finding the Sweet Spot

Pricing is a delicate balance between profitability and competitiveness. Tools can help analyze your competitor’s pricing and suggest optimal pricing strategies. While undercutting your competitors might seem appealing, it’s crucial to ensure profitability. You also need to consider factors like your costs and profit margins when setting your price. Experimentation and careful monitoring are essential.

Tracking and Monitoring: Measuring Your Success

Regularly tracking your keyword rankings, sales, and other key metrics is crucial for optimizing your Amazon SEO strategy. Most of the tools mentioned above provide robust tracking and reporting features. This data allows you to identify what’s working, what’s not, and make necessary adjustments to maximize your results. Continuous monitoring ensures you’re adapting to changes in the market and the A9 algorithm.

A/B Testing: Refining Your Listing

A/B testing allows you to experiment with different versions of your listing (title, bullet points, images, etc.) to see which performs better. While not directly a tool itself, many platforms incorporate A/B testing functionalities, enabling you to refine your listing based on data rather than guesswork. This iterative process helps optimize your listing for maximum conversion rates and improved rankings.

Beyond the Tools: The Human Element

While tools are invaluable, don’t overlook the importance of human judgment and creativity. The best SEO strategy combines data-driven insights from tools with a keen understanding of your target audience and product. The tools provide the data; you need to interpret that data and use it to create compelling listings that resonate with your customers.

Staying Updated: Amazon’s Algorithm Changes

Amazon’s A9 algorithm is constantly evolving. Staying informed about algorithm updates and best practices is essential for long-term success. Follow industry blogs, participate in Amazon seller forums, and keep your ear to the ground to ensure your strategies remain effective in the face of ongoing algorithm changes.
